Auld played 283 times for the Glasgow sideChairman pays tribute to ‘Mr Celtic’: ‘He was a giant of a player’The former Celtic midfielder Bertie Auld, who was part of the European Cup-winning Lisbon Lions team of 1967, has died at the age of 83, the Scottish Premiership club said on Sunday.
Auld made 283 appearances and scored 85 goals for Celtic in two spells, winning five league titles, four League Cups, three Scottish Cups and the European Cup in 1967 when they beat Internazionale 2-1.
